Coal India likely to end FY16 with 535-540 mt output
28 Mar 2016
Coal India Ltd (CIL) is likely to end the current financial year (2016-17) with actual production of anywhere between 535-540 million tons (mt), an official from the company told ICMW.
Thus, the company is likely to miss its output target of 550 mt for the year.
“We could have ended with slightly higher production during the year, but for low demand for coal from power sector consumers,” the official said, adding, “Production had to be deliberately reduced at some of the mines recently because of lower lifting, particularly from the power sector.”
As of March 15, CIL had produced about 504 mt of coal while the offtake stood at around 507 mt.
